If you are a fan of The Boys, then you will probably be aware by now that the series wraps up with issue #72 (so around a year left to go). But if you are curious how the series may end, some interviews over the last few months have provided a little more insight. From the following interviews;

we know that;
1) There are only 2 arcs left -the first has just kicked off with issue #60, ‘Over the Hill with the Swords of a Thousand Men’
2) The final arc will run from #66 to #71.
3) #72, the final issue, will be an epilogue.
4) There will be no more spin-offs from the main series.
5) Once The Boys ends, there will be no more comics or series featuring these characters.
6) Aside from Team Titanic, there will be one more superhero team introduced to the series.
7) A lot of history on The Seven, and particularly The Homelander, will be covered in the current arc ‘…Swords of a Thousand men’.
8) #63 should be interesting for Queen Maeve fans.
9) There is no question of Annie, having left The Seven, becoming part of The Boys.
10) Ennis completed the writing for the final issue in the summer.
